The Do It Yourself Doula™ Childbirth Education Classes aim to provide comprehensive education and support for couples and a third person during the labor and birthing process. This course combines the Lamaze philosophy with the gentle approach of doula work, focusing on the comfort and well-being of the birthing mother. Participants will gain confidence in their ability to navigate the challenges of childbirth and be prepared for any unexpected events. The course covers topics such as natural and medical labor options, coping with epidurals, and making C-sections more mother and baby centered. It also includes breastfeeding support, labor comfort measures, and preparation for bringing the baby home. While this course does not replace the need for a trained doula, it offers an alternative for those who cannot afford or choose not to hire one. The course emphasizes the importance of having a supportive third person present during birth and aims to empower women to trust in their body's ability to give birth in their preferred way.
